“…Thymol (2-isopropyl-5-methylphenol) is a major constituent of the essential oils from plants of the genus Lippia and Thymis (GOMES et al, 2011;ELANDALOUSI et al, 2013) and presents in vitro anthelmintic activity on H. contortus (CAMURÇA-VASCONCELOS et al 2007;ELANDALOUSI et al, 2013;FERREIRA et al, 2016). It is a phenolic compound causing high toxicity due to the presence of the hydroxyl radical.…”

“…These findings could also be compared with Akkari et al (2014) who recorded the findings that the maximum concentration required to induce complete (100%) egg hatch inhibition for crude aqueous and ethanolic extracts was 2 mg/ml. Thymus capitatus (another important pastoral species form arid Tunisia) aqueous and ethanolic extracts totally inhibited H. contortus egg hatching at 2 mg/ml concentration (Landolsi et al, 2013).…”
